This technical report discusses the transition towards autonomous networking in the context of the evolving digital business environment. It outlines the increasing complexity and criticality of network infrastructures, emphasizing the necessity for automation to meet rising demands for efficiency and responsiveness. The report presents findings from IDC research indicating that a significant percentage of business executives recognize the benefits of automated AI-powered networks in supporting digital initiatives. It details the challenges faced by organizations, including network complexity, limited visibility, and the risks of manual management practices. The report also highlights critical requirements for successful network automation, such as detailed network intelligence, deep insights, deterministic outcomes, and directed management actions. Furthermore, it identifies barriers to achieving fully autonomous networks, including inadequate governance and unified management practices. The document underscores the importance of leveraging advanced AI technologies to enhance network automation and improve operational efficiency.
